Effects of rice-duck farming system on Oryza sativa growth and its yield
|
Abstract:
The study showed that under rice-duck farming,the number of rice non-productive tiller reduced significantly,the ratio of its effective panicles increased by 8.08%,and its basal penetration light rate enhanced by 4.05%.At full-heading and maturing stages,the green leaf ratio under rice-duck farming was 6.01% and 10.65% higher than the control,and the leaf chlorophyll content was increased by 2.90% and 17.82%,respectively.Under rice-duck farming,the root vigour at full-heading stage and the photosynthesis capability of flag leaf at grain-filling stage were increased by 24.2% and 15.73%,which could accumulate more assimilative matter,and increase the harvest index and yield by 2.87% and 4.93%,respectively.
